Output 81ef2aa40f6678dc84fc08782418c311d2a98fbd6c2214929bd5f79a524b7b34:2

value
59657323
script pubkey
OP_0 OP_PUSHBYTES_20 af1a2a0c354e8f49c7b02630004c945734f158f5
address
ltc1q4udz5rp4f685n3asyccqqny52u60zk848tkals
transaction
81ef2aa40f6678dc84fc08782418c311d2a98fbd6c2214929bd5f79a524b7b34
spent
true